%0 Journal Article %T An Supporting Tool Based on Design Flowchart
面向设计流图的代码支撑工具 %A DAI Qing-Han %A LI Xuan-Dong %A ZHAO Jian-Hu %A ZHENG Guo-Liang %A
戴清涵 %A 李宣东 %A 赵建华 %A 郑国梁 %J 计算机科学 %D 2005 %I %X The stability of telecom system is especially important. Coding and testing affect the stability of code. Ma- chine-generated code will contain less bugs than manual-typed code, and the former provides convenience for tracing and testing. For the sake of stability, this paper puts forward the concept of Design Flowchart through referencing UML. related theory. This paper also describes the theory and application of auto generating code based on Design Flowchart. The first part of this paper is about the advantage of Design Flowchart in software development. The sec- ond part is about the concept of Design Flowchart. The auto-generated-code algorithm is written in the third part. The forth part describes the tracing and testing. The last part introduces the relative tool. This paper describes how to auto generate code from Design Flowchart in detail and how to trace and test the generated code in simple. This paper also realizes an IDE named AutoCodeGen. Some work can be done in the IDE, sueh as editing flowchart, checking flow- chart, compiling flowchart, compiling code, executing flowchart (executing the compiled code), tracing and testing based on flowchart. In practice, AutoCodeGen is used to generate part of code of TCAP protocol. %K Design flowchart %K Task node %K Transmit edge
设计流图 %K 任务节点 %K 转换边 %K 面向设计 %K 代码生成 %K 支撑工具 %K 流图 %K 自动生成算法 %K 集成开发环境 %K 测试方法 %U http://www.alljournals.cn/get_abstract_url.aspx?pcid=5B3AB970F71A803DEACDC0559115BFCF0A068CD97DD29835&cid=8240383F08CE46C8B05036380D75B607&jid=64A12D73428C8B8DBFB978D04DFEB3C1&aid=BC7E71A3370E202C&yid=2DD7160C83D0ACED&vid=9971A5E270697F23&iid=708DD6B15D2464E8&sid=38685BC770C663F2&eid=9F6DA927E843CD50&journal_id=1002-137X&journal_name=计算机科学&referenced_num=0&reference_num=5